gpt4 book ai didi

css - 如何使用 Asp.Net MVC Razor 语法通过循环连续显示 3 个元素

转载 作者:行者123 更新时间:2023-12-01 22:36:29 24 4
gpt4 key购买 nike

enter image description here我遇到了一个场景,我想连续显示 3 个元素。我成功地连续显示了 2 个元素。我试过了,但无法连续显示 3 个元素。在这方面的任何帮助将不胜感激。

这是我试过的代码片段

    @model  IList<MvcApplication1.tblTest>
@{
ViewBag.Title = "Index";
Layout = "~/Views/Shared/_Layout.cshtml";
}

<h2>Displaying three items(products) in a row</h2>

<div style="display: inline-block">

@for (var i = 0; i < Model.Count(); i++)
{

<div style="display: inline-block">

<div> @Model[i].testId</div>
<div>@Model[i].testName</div>
<div>@Model[i].testDescription</div>

</div>

if (i% 3 == 1)
{
<br />
}
}
</div>

最佳答案

尝试 i%3 ==2

@model  IList<MvcApplication1.tblTest>
@{
ViewBag.Title = "Index";
Layout = "~/Views/Shared/_Layout.cshtml";
}

<h2>Displaying three items(products) in a row</h2>

<div style="display: inline-block">

@for (var i = 0; i < Model.Count(); i++)
{

<div style="display: inline-block">

<div> @Model[i].testId</div>
<div>@Model[i].testName</div>
<div>@Model[i].testDescription</div>

</div>

if (i% 3 == 2)
{
<br />
}
}
</div>

关于css - 如何使用 Asp.Net MVC Razor 语法通过循环连续显示 3 个元素,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22339133/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com